- Restoring damaged spinal cords. See how we make graphene nanoribbons by the longitudinal unzipping of carbon nanotubes and how we used those to repair the spinal cord in a rodent. The rodent, after its spinal cord had been completed cut in two, started walking again two weeks after application of the graphene nanoribbons. After three weeks the rodent scored a 19 out of 21 on a mobility scale, where 21 is optimal mobility. This is also being studied for healing peripheral nerves and optic nerves, the latter being studied to restore sight to the blind.
